#1

Dub

Dub is a modern link management platform that helps you create short links, track their performance, and integrate them into your marketing strategies. It is particularly useful if you are a marketer or developer looking for a straightforward, API-first approach to managing your URLs, offering powerful analytics to understand link engagement.

This tool allows you to customize your short links with your own domains, providing a professional and branded experience for your audience. Dub also supports QR code generation and offers a robust API, which means you can automate your link creation and management processes, making it a great choice for tech-savvy users.

#2

Bitly

Bitly is a well-known link management tool that allows you to shorten, brand, and track your links with ease. It's an excellent choice if you are a business or individual who needs to manage a high volume of links across various campaigns, providing a reliable and scalable solution for your link management needs.

This platform offers comprehensive analytics, which helps you understand how your links perform across different channels, giving you valuable insights into your audience's engagement. Bitly's strength lies in its simplicity and widespread adoption, making it a go-to for quick link shortening and performance monitoring.

#4

Short.io

Short.io is a link shortener that prioritizes custom domains and detailed analytics, making it a strong contender for your professional link management needs. It is particularly well-suited if you are a business or individual looking for powerful link customization and advanced tracking features without unnecessary complexity.

This platform allows you to create branded short links, integrate with various tools through its API, and gain deep insights into your link performance. Short.io emphasizes ease of use combined with robust functionality, providing features like link cloaking and geotargeting, which means you can optimize your links for different audiences and campaigns.

#6

Sniply

Sniply allows you to add a call-to-action to any shared link, turning curated content into lead generation opportunities for your business. It is a powerful tool if you are a marketer seeking to drive conversions and engage your audience by embedding your own message onto third-party articles or content.

This platform helps you create custom banners and buttons that appear on shared links, which means you can promote your own content or offerings even when sharing external resources. Sniply's ability to drive traffic back to your site from any link makes it a unique and effective tool for content curation and lead capture.

#9

ClickMagick

ClickMagick is an all-in-one ad tracking and link management platform designed to help you optimize your marketing campaigns and maximize your ROI. It is a powerful solution if you are an affiliate marketer, e-commerce business, or advertiser needing precise tracking, funnel optimization, and fraud detection.

This platform offers detailed click tracking, conversion attribution, and split testing capabilities, which means you can accurately measure the performance of every link and ad. ClickMagick's robust feature set allows you to monitor your entire sales funnel, identify profitable campaigns, and protect your ad spend from bot traffic, making it a comprehensive tool for serious marketers.

#10

T2Mio

T2Mio is a comprehensive URL shortener and QR code generator that offers advanced tracking and management features for your links. It is a suitable choice if you are a business or marketer looking for a robust solution to create, manage, and analyze your short URLs and QR codes with precision.

This platform provides detailed analytics, which means you can monitor click-through rates, geographic data, and referral sources to optimize your campaigns. T2Mio also supports custom domains, bulk link creation, and password-protected links, making it a versatile tool for various link management needs, from simple sharing to advanced campaign tracking.
